I have had this 3D embossing folder for ages and probably only used it once!
I thought I'd try the blackout technique with it, but instead of completely covering the card with ink, I just blackened around the debossed areas so the tools stood out more.

I used some designer paper from Craft Consortium, it held up well being embossed with the 3D folder.
